lIlLeftyI

You have to start appreciating the grind of betting -110's (or -140's, etc. ... value isn't always anything with a "+" in front of it) and looking for an edge. Betting for profit is not for everyone, and is usually not as fun. Have to learn self restraint and understand the difference between handicapping and gambling.


TheCashmanWins

Parlays are a losing venture. That is why sportsbooks are always offering bonuses for Parlays. If you are going to profit in gambling (which I do), you have to be disciplined and not think that you have to place a bet every day. You only need 1 good bet to make a profit. People think they have to be 4 or 5 games a day. That is not the way to go about it. It is a long term venture. Look at your performance in 30 day increments. Keep your bet amounts consistent. Don't chase. Place your bets for the day. There will be more games tomorrow. Disciplined people have a chance to profit. Impulsive people will struggle.

Antoinej27

Usually straight bets are easier for ufc or boxing. You can spot certain fighters strengths or weaknesses fairly easily. Especially if you follow the undercards you’ll get to know most fighters path’s to victory and also how they lose. There’s gonna be juicy odds for things like method of victory and round/method etc. You’ll get +300 and up for mov and +700 and up for method and round usually. With most cards you’ll only find a couple of those guys you know well enough, but there’s cards you get 4-6 fights. The main thing is to know both fighters well. As for boxing it gets a bit easier, but for this you will have to live bet and spot your openings. Fighters that were favoured big pre fight that look like they’re getting their shit kicked, if it’s in their own country bet the decision for them. If they have even a few shining moments they’ll get a split.

Steel_Wheel_A2345

Depends on the sport. Basically I look for anything with +++money. Expected value of any monetary risk (sports, poker, etc) is basically: Frequency of win X Amount won. Just for example sake, if you win once out of every ten times you try, then you have to be making 10x your money back. If you win once out 5, then you only have to make 5x. It’s less apparent with smaller numbers. Straight bets are safer for sure, sport depending. I personally only bet MLB, NBA, and WNBA.

mejeff2

Very carefully. If you want to make money off your own insight, you almost have to treat it like a job. I primarily bet golf for money. I spend hours every week reading about the course, weather conditions, the players, combing stats, etc, before placing my bets. I watch as much as I can of each tournament to get a better feeling of how everyones playing. I have a system and I stick to it whether things are going well that week or not(no trying to make up for bad days). I bet mlb for fun.
